Grants – Big ideas can start the engine…But funding gets you on the road. Through the first-ever private sector grant supplemental, I offered clear, specific ways states, tribes and territories can use Homeland Security grant funding to support public-private collaboration. As just one example, these grants can be used to fund the salary for a dedicated liaison who acts as the primary point of contact on private sector collaboration. Funds can also be used to work in partnership on tools, resources, training, exercises, information sharing and more.

Disaster Assistance Communications – I learned that it is not only useful to communicate with the private sector, but to also leverage their vast capabilities and networks to communicate through the private sector to survivors and communities in need during a disaster. I have seen amazing outreach through outdoor billboards, hotel welcome channel videos, aircraft supported messages, billing statements, restaurant signage and the list continues to grow.
